|
|
|
@ -1,46 +1,94 @@ |
|
|
|
<template> |
|
|
|
<div> |
|
|
|
<div class="seach"> |
|
|
|
<div class="seach_item"> |
|
|
|
<span>挂牌代码</span> |
|
|
|
<el-input v-model="query.cartellino_id" placeholder="请输入挂牌代码" class="seach_input"></el-input> |
|
|
|
<div class="seach1"> |
|
|
|
<div class="seach1_item"> |
|
|
|
<span> |
|
|
|
全部资产 ( |
|
|
|
<span class="seach1_item_span">{{pageTotal}}</span> |
|
|
|
) |
|
|
|
</span> |
|
|
|
</div> |
|
|
|
<div class="seach1_item"> |
|
|
|
<el-select v-model="query.sort" @change="getData"> |
|
|
|
<el-option :key="0" label="资产价格升序" :value="1"></el-option> |
|
|
|
<el-option :key="1" label="资产价格降序" :value="2"></el-option> |
|
|
|
<el-option :key="2" label="挂牌时间升序" :value="3"></el-option> |
|
|
|
<el-option :key="3" label="挂牌时间降序" :value="4"></el-option> |
|
|
|
</el-select> |
|
|
|
</div> |
|
|
|
<div class="seach1_item"> |
|
|
|
<el-date-picker |
|
|
|
v-model="query.create_time" |
|
|
|
type="date" |
|
|
|
placeholder="选择日期" |
|
|
|
format="yyyy 年 MM 月 dd 日" |
|
|
|
value-format="yyyy-MM-dd" |
|
|
|
@change="getData"> |
|
|
|
</el-date-picker> |
|
|
|
</div> |
|
|
|
<div class="seach_item"> |
|
|
|
<span>标的挂牌类型</span> |
|
|
|
<el-select v-model="query.cartellino_type" placeholder="全部" class="seach_input"> |
|
|
|
<el-option key="1" label="全部" value="全部"></el-option> |
|
|
|
<el-option key="2" label="协议" value="协议"></el-option> |
|
|
|
<el-option key="3" label="拍卖" value="拍卖"></el-option> |
|
|
|
<div class="seach1_item"> |
|
|
|
<span>价格</span> |
|
|
|
<el-input |
|
|
|
class="seach_input" |
|
|
|
v-model="query.min_price"> |
|
|
|
<span slot="prefix" class="el-input__icon ">¥</span> |
|
|
|
</el-input> |
|
|
|
<span>-</span> |
|
|
|
<el-input |
|
|
|
class="seach_input" |
|
|
|
v-model="query.max_price"> |
|
|
|
<span slot="prefix" class="el-input__icon ">¥</span> |
|
|
|
</el-input> |
|
|
|
<button @click="getData" class="seach_button">确定</button> |
|
|
|
</div> |
|
|
|
</div> |
|
|
|
|
|
|
|
<div class="seach1"> |
|
|
|
<div class="seach1_item"> |
|
|
|
<span>挂牌类型</span> |
|
|
|
<el-select v-model="query.cartellino_type" @change="getData" class="seach1_select"> |
|
|
|
<el-option :key="0" label="全部" value=""></el-option> |
|
|
|
<el-option :key="1" label="协议" :value="1"></el-option> |
|
|
|
<el-option :key="2" label="拍卖" :value="2"></el-option> |
|
|
|
</el-select> |
|
|
|
</div> |
|
|
|
<div class="seach_item"> |
|
|
|
<span>标的资产类型</span> |
|
|
|
<el-input v-model="query.cartellino_type" placeholder="请输入资产类型关键字" class="seach_input"></el-input> |
|
|
|
<div class="seach1_item"> |
|
|
|
<span>挂牌方名称</span> |
|
|
|
<el-input |
|
|
|
class="seach1_select" |
|
|
|
placeholder="请输入挂牌方关键字" |
|
|
|
v-model="query.sell_name"> |
|
|
|
</el-input> |
|
|
|
</div> |
|
|
|
<div class="seach_item"> |
|
|
|
<div class="seach1_item"> |
|
|
|
<span>挂牌编号</span> |
|
|
|
<el-input |
|
|
|
class="seach1_select" |
|
|
|
placeholder="请输入挂牌编号" |
|
|
|
v-model="query.cartellino_id"> |
|
|
|
</el-input> |
|
|
|
</div> |
|
|
|
<div class="seach1_item"> |
|
|
|
<span>标的名称</span> |
|
|
|
<el-input v-model="query.asset_name" placeholder="请输入标的名称关键字" class="seach_input"></el-input> |
|
|
|
<el-input |
|
|
|
class="seach1_select" |
|
|
|
placeholder="请输入标的名称关键字" |
|
|
|
v-model="query.asset_name"> |
|
|
|
</el-input> |
|
|
|
</div> |
|
|
|
<div class="seach1_item"> |
|
|
|
<button @click="getData" class="seach_button">确定</button> |
|
|
|
</div> |
|
|
|
</div> |
|
|
|
|
|
|
|
<el-dropdown trigger="click"> |
|
|
|
<span class="el-dropdown-link"> |
|
|
|
排序<i class="el-icon-arrow-down el-icon--right"></i> |
|
|
|
</span> |
|
|
|
<el-dropdown-menu slot="dropdown"> |
|
|
|
<el-dropdown-item>黄金糕</el-dropdown-item> |
|
|
|
<el-dropdown-item>狮子头</el-dropdown-item> |
|
|
|
<el-dropdown-item>螺蛳粉</el-dropdown-item> |
|
|
|
<el-dropdown-item disabled>双皮奶</el-dropdown-item> |
|
|
|
<el-dropdown-item divided>蚵仔煎</el-dropdown-item> |
|
|
|
</el-dropdown-menu> |
|
|
|
</el-dropdown> |
|
|
|
</div> |
|
|
|
|
|
|
|
<div class="tabs"> |
|
|
|
<el-table |
|
|
|
:data="listData" |
|
|
|
header-cell-class-name="theader" |
|
|
|
:header-cell-style="{background:'#F8E6E6 !important',color:'#C94C4C',height:'60px',fontSize:'14px'}" |
|
|
|
:header-cell-style="{background:'#F3F3F3 !important',color:'#333333',height:'60px',fontSize:'14px'}" |
|
|
|
style="width: 100%"> |
|
|
|
<el-table-column |
|
|
|
prop="asset_id" |
|
|
|
@ -111,7 +159,7 @@ export default { |
|
|
|
query:{ |
|
|
|
page:1, |
|
|
|
limit:10, |
|
|
|
sort:'', |
|
|
|
sort:1, |
|
|
|
create_time:'', |
|
|
|
min_price:'', |
|
|
|
max_price:'', |
|
|
|
@ -130,7 +178,7 @@ export default { |
|
|
|
methods:{ |
|
|
|
//时间戳转换时间 |
|
|
|
formatDate(row,colnum){ |
|
|
|
return moment(row.create_time*1000).format('YYYY-MM-DD HH:mm:ss') |
|
|
|
return moment(row[colnum.property]*1000).format('YYYY-MM-DD HH:mm:ss') |
|
|
|
}, |
|
|
|
getData(){ |
|
|
|
delist(this.query).then(res => { |
|
|
|
@ -153,29 +201,53 @@ export default { |
|
|
|
</script> |
|
|
|
<style scoped> |
|
|
|
.seach{ |
|
|
|
display: flex; |
|
|
|
background-color: #FDF8F8; |
|
|
|
border: 1px solid #E9B7B7; |
|
|
|
margin: 20px 0; |
|
|
|
} |
|
|
|
.seach1_select{ |
|
|
|
margin-left: 10px; |
|
|
|
width: 170px; |
|
|
|
} |
|
|
|
.seach_button{ |
|
|
|
width: 60px; |
|
|
|
height: 30px; |
|
|
|
font-size: 12px; |
|
|
|
color: #333333; |
|
|
|
background-color: transparent; |
|
|
|
border:1px solid #D7D7D7; |
|
|
|
cursor: pointer; |
|
|
|
} |
|
|
|
.seach_input{ |
|
|
|
width: 100px; |
|
|
|
margin: 0 15px; |
|
|
|
} |
|
|
|
.seach1{ |
|
|
|
width: 100%; |
|
|
|
height: 50px; |
|
|
|
margin-top: 30px; |
|
|
|
padding: 0 15px; |
|
|
|
justify-content: space-between; |
|
|
|
background: #F2F2F2; |
|
|
|
border: 1px solid #D7D7D7; |
|
|
|
box-sizing: border-box; |
|
|
|
display: flex; |
|
|
|
align-items: center; |
|
|
|
} |
|
|
|
.seach_item{ |
|
|
|
.seach1:last-child{ |
|
|
|
border-top: none; |
|
|
|
} |
|
|
|
.seach1_item{ |
|
|
|
padding: 0 20px; |
|
|
|
display: flex; |
|
|
|
align-items: center; |
|
|
|
font-size: 14px; |
|
|
|
|
|
|
|
border-right: 1px solid #D7D7D7; |
|
|
|
font-size: 12px; |
|
|
|
height: 100%; |
|
|
|
} |
|
|
|
.seach_input{ |
|
|
|
width: 170px; |
|
|
|
border: 1px solid #E9B7B7; |
|
|
|
margin-left: 15px; |
|
|
|
.seach1_item_span{ |
|
|
|
color: #C94C4C; |
|
|
|
} |
|
|
|
.seach1_item:last-child{ |
|
|
|
border-right: none; |
|
|
|
} |
|
|
|
.seach_input>>>.el-input__inner{ |
|
|
|
border: none; |
|
|
|
padding-left: 5px; |
|
|
|
.select_city{ |
|
|
|
margin: 0 15px; |
|
|
|
} |
|
|
|
.el-dropdown-link{ |
|
|
|
color: #EAB1B1; |
|
|
|
|